vacation rental description
This home is located just 2.5 miles from the Courthouse Square in Prescott and sits on top of a hill with unobstructed views of the mountains, boulders and pines that surround this serene romantic hide away aptly named Amnesia Two.
A fully-equipped, gourmet kitchen makes meals and snacks a breeze. Central A/C and heat. Plenty of ceiling fans make this a very comfortable place to call home.
All beds are memory foam. The master bath has a double vanity, large soaking tub. There is an additional ADA equipped bathroom off the living room with walk-in shower with dual heads.
Outside living is at it's best. The deck leads out to various sitting areas. Take off your shoes and sink them in the grassy, secluded backyard. There is a gas grill if you feel like showing off your culinary skills.
Lots of, games, music CDs and puzzles make relaxing easy.
A 55" flat-screen TV with blue-ray can be viewed in the theatre room, living room and kitchen. High speed internet. A washer/dryer adds convenience for longer stays. There is also an additional Arizona room for additional space and comfort. Cell phones have good reception.

activities and attractions in Prescott Arizona
And once you are here, Prescott, Arizona is a great area to
explore. From the World's Oldest Rodeo to the mile-high
golf courses, Prescott has something for everyone to see or do
... antique shops, art galleries, museums, casinos, hiking, fine
dining or just people watching at the historic, downtown Courthouse
Square. There are mountain biking trails Horseback riding and
real "cowboy experiences" can be found around the area as well. On selected
weekends the Downtown Courthouse Square hosts a number of different arts
and crafts festivals for finding that unique gift or keepsake from Prescott.
Phoenix, Verde Valley and the National Forest are all easy day trips.
